> It is GPL licensed with an amendment which prevents the GPL spreading to
> other open source software with which it is linked.
>
> "In accordance with section 10 of the GPL, Red Hat, Inc. permits programs
> whose sources are distributed under a license that complies with the Open
> Source definition to be linked with libcygwin.a without libcygwin.a itself
> causing the resulting program to be covered by the GNU GPL."
If I understand this right, I cannot produce commercial software with
the cygwin toolset.
